Summary

This propeller is designed and was flown on the DJI Mavic Mini. I printed the propellers with a SLA printer. The trailing edge is 0.2mm thick, so don't use a nozzle diameter larger than that if you are going to use FDM without increasing the perimeter offset.

I measured the stock propellers hovering rpm at about 9500 rpm using a tachometer. The original propeller diameter of the stock propeller is 120mm. This design will be about 121mm when mounted on the stock motors. These motors put the axis of folding rotation of the propeller 5mm from the propellers thrusting axis of rotation. Based on those conditions, I designed this propeller to perform at a similar RPM, and create 250/4 grams of thrust. This way the motor will remain well matched to the propeller. I have not yet had the chance to test the motor and consider the KV and voltage in the propeller design. This propeller uses a triple variable airfoil design.

I really like this folding propeller mounting design. I know it likely has it thrust limits, but it is light, simple and hard to mess up. To bad the screws are so custom.
